Calculating tangential cutting force

Tangential cutting force for aluminum.

Ft = σ × A × Zc × Ef × Tf

Ultimate tensile strength (σ) = 310mpa
Cross-sectional area of the uncut chip (A) =  2*0.0762 = 0.1524mm
Number of teeth engaged with a workpiece (Zc) 3/(360/180)=1.5
Engagement factor of a workpiece material (Ef) = 1.1 from previous post and website link
Cutting tool wear factor (Tf) = 1.1 from table on web page.

 Ft = 310 * 0.1524 * 1.5 * 1.1 * 1.1  = 86 N 2SF
 

Tangential cutting force for MDF.

Ft = σ × A × Zc × Ef × Tf

Ultimate tensile strength (σ) = 18mpa
Cross-sectional area of the uncut chip (A) =  3.125*0.2 = 0.625mm
Number of teeth engaged with a workpiece (Zc) 2/(360/180)=1
Engagement factor of a workpiece material (Ef) = 1.1 from previous post and website link
Cutting tool wear factor (Tf) = 1.2 from table on web page.

 Ft = 18 * 0.625 * 1 * 1.1 * 1.2  = 15 N 2SF
